1. Clustering in Swedish : The Impact of some Properties of the Swedish Language on Document Clustering and an Evaluation Method
Abstract : Text clustering divides a set of texts into groups, so that texts within each group are similar in content. It may be used to uncover the structure and content of unknown text sets as well as to give new perspectives on known ones. READ MORE

3. Multi-Document Summarization and Semantic Relatedness
Abstract : Automatic summarization is the process of presenting the contents of written documents in a short, comprehensive fashion. Many approaches have been proposed for this problem, some of which extract content from the input documents (extractive methods), and others that generate the language in the summary based on some representation of the document contents (abstractive methods).
